The events leading up to Alex's death remain controversial. The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) claimed that the agents were attempting to apprehend an individual wanted for violent assault when they were approached by Pretti. According to DHS, Alex was armed and carrying a gun with two magazines at the time he was detained. However, video footage from the scene shows Alex with only a phone in his hand, contradicting the agency's statements about the incident.

The footage raises serious questions about the accuracy of the DHS's claims and the justification for the use of lethal force. The videos depict a scuffle during which agents removed a 9 mm semiautomatic handgun from Alex, leading to the fatal shooting. This discrepancy between the official narrative and the visual evidence has fueled public outrage and calls for a thorough investigation into the incident.

Minneapolis Police Chief Brian O'Hara confirmed that Alex had no serious criminal history, with only minor parking violations recorded. He was also a lawful gun owner with a valid permit. This information adds another layer of complexity to the situation, challenging the narrative put forth by the DHS and prompting further scrutiny into the actions of the agents involved.
